Project Almanac (2015)
Brilliant
What would you if you invented a time machine? Change history? Win the lotto? Fix all your lifes mistakes? The lead actor, Jonny Weston (as David Raskin), as the son of a brilliant scientist, who is a genius himself, discovers his fathers hidden secret works, the device that would eventually be turned into a time machine and makes it a reality. He teams up with his fellow classmates, who help him develop the machine. They test it, travelling as a group, back in time to lesser events in history, a few hours, then a few days, then on to years. Each return trip back to the present shows signs of an alternate future, mostly for good, but with a few bad things thrown in. After a few trips back solo, David changes the past and the present in radical ways he can no longer control. The present time events become so screwed up he has to go back in time, before his father disappears and destroy the machine that started this whole thing. It's all shot POV as if by a hand-held device, to give it that amateur shot live feel, as in a documentary (think Blair Witch Project). The story is brilliant and make you think. Superb acting by relative unknown actors. I will definitely watch this one again soon.

1941 (1979)
This movie is so ridiculous it's funny.They don't make em like this anymore.
This movie is so ridiculous it's fun. Seen it many years ago, and it's still fun to watch, like Airplane, Cannonball Run and Blazing Saddles. They just don't make racy movies like this anymore, with exception to Django Unchained. It takes place just after the attack on Pearl Harbor, and Californians are worried about an attack on the west coast by the Japanese. So everyone comes to arms to defend the West coast. Including local folk, the armed forces, and everyone inbetween. John Belushi is hilarious as the crazy fighter pilot who is tracking a Japanese fighter group who has supposedly set up a base in California. Dan Akroyd plays a devote army fighter uniting all the different service units to fight the enemy and not fight each other. There's a love story in there too. Lot's of chaos. Lot's of action. Lot's of funny, as peeps deal with the idea of Japan invading America. It's a fun film.
